Stackable Tower Lighting, Beacons, and Components

Stackable Tower Lighting, Beacons, and Components are modular industrial signaling devices used to convey visual and audible information in automated systems. These components integrate LED technology, communication protocols, and robust mechanical designs to provide status indication, alerts, and control functions. They play a critical role in enhancing operational efficiency, safety, and system diagnostics in modern manufacturing, logistics, and process industries.

Typical stackable tower lighting systems consist of: - Extruded Aluminum Housing for mechanical durability - LED Arrays with color-selectable segments - Internal PCB Stack for power distribution and signal processing - Quick-Connect Cables for daisy-chaining modules - Base Mounting Adapters (wall/din-rail/panel mount options) Communication integration includes protocols like Ethernet/IP and Modbus TCP/IP.

Parameter Value/Range Importance
Voltage Range 12-24V DC, 110-240V AC Ensures compatibility with control systems
IP Rating IP65 (standard), IP69K (hygienic areas) Dust/water ingress protection
Communication Protocols Modbus, Profinet, IO-Link Integration with PLCs and IIoT platforms
Operating Temperature -20 C to +55 C Environmental reliability

Key industries include: - Automotive Manufacturing: Assembly line status monitoring - Pharmaceutical Production: Cleanroom-compliant signaling - Logistics Systems: Picking station order confirmation - Food Processing: Hygienic zone equipment alerts - Semiconductor Fabrication: ESD-safe tower light integration

Key considerations: - Environmental conditions (temperature, humidity, vibration) - Communication protocol compatibility with existing PLC systems - Modularity requirements for future expansion - Mounting space constraints - Maintenance accessibility (e.g., LED lifespan >50,000 hours) - Industry-specific certifications (ATEX, UL, CE)

Emerging developments include: - Integration with IIoT platforms for predictive maintenance - Adoption of wireless mesh networks (e.g., Bluetooth 5.0) - Increased use of RGB-LED technology for multi-state indication - Development of AI-enabled smart beacons with adaptive signaling - Growth in modular designs supporting rapid field replacements - Energy efficiency improvements through optimized LED drivers
